Southampton Lining Up Atletico Madrid Ace Thomas Partey as Victor Wanyama's Replacement

Published on: 26 June 2016

Southampton are lining up Atletico Madrid aceThomas Partey as Victor Wanyama's replacement,Mirror Sportreports.


Partey moved to the Vicente Calderon back in 2011 and he has slowly worked his way up the ranks.


The tough-tackling midfielder made several appearances for Atleti in La Liga this season and he made a brief cameo in the Champions League final defeat at the hands of Real Madrid.

However, the 23-year-old has struggled to pin down a regular spot in the starting XI and he could be lured by the prospect of guaranteed first-team football.


The Saints have earmarked Partey as a potential transfer target following Wanyama's decision to join Tottenham Hotspur.


The Kenyan midfielder was hugely popular amongst theSt. Mary's Stadium faithful due to his battling displays,yet he has been swayed by the prospect of challenging for trophies under his former boss Mauricio Pochettino at White Hart Lane.

Spurs splashed out £11m on the 25-year-old's signature and Southampton quickly reinvested that by snapping up Nathan Redmond from Norwich.


The Saints are bracing themselves for another summer filled with turmoil after manager Ronald Koeman jumped ship to join Everton whilsttheirprized assets are set to be snatched awayas Premier League rivals circle aroundSadio Mane, Virgil van Dijk and Graziano Pelle.
